For the quarter ended March 2025, AvalonBay Communities (AVB) reported revenue of $745.88 million, up 4.6% over the same period last year. EPS came in at $2.83, compared to $1.22 in the year-ago quarter.
The reported revenue represents a surprise of -0.19% over the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$747.26 million. With the consensus EPS estimate being $2.80, the EPS surprise was +1.07%.

Here is how AvalonBay performed in the just reported quarter in terms of the metrics most widely monitored and projected by Wall Street analysts:
- Same Store Economic Occupancy: 96% compared to the 95.8% average estimate based on four analysts.
- Revenue- Rental and other income: $744.14 million versus the six-analyst average estimate of $744.31 million. The reported number represents a year-over-year change of +4.7%.
- Revenue- Management, development and other fees: $1.74 million compared to the $1.98 million average estimate based on five analysts. The reported number represents a change of -3% year over year.
- Net Earnings Per Share (Diluted): $1.66 versus the seven-analyst average estimate of $1.31.
